The P1 Series Rail Wheels are high-performance engineering solutions specifically designed for Hybrid Rail-Road Vehicles (RRVs) and heavy-duty industrial operations. Engineered with a specialized P1 tread profile, these wheels maximize rail adhesion and lateral stability, significantly reducing slippage and the risk of derailment during complex transitions between road and rail environments.
Forged from premium-grade carbon and alloy steels, the P1 series combines exceptional load-bearing capacity with rigorous industry compliance. Whether deployed in mining, warehousing, or urban infrastructure, these wheels ensure seamless integration with standard 1435mm gauges, delivering a synergy of safety, durability, and operational efficiency for B2B fleet managers worldwide.

P1 wheels feature an optimized tread profile that enhances rail contact and lateral stability. By maintaining even pressure along the flange and tread, they prevent sudden shifts during transitions between road and rail, especially under heavy loads.
We use premium-grade carbon and alloy steels, including C55, C60, 65Mn, ER6, ER7, CL60, 4140, 4330, 4340, and 42CrMo. These materials are selected for their high resistance to wear and structural integrity under stress.
Proper lubrication of the P1 tread profile minimizes friction between the wheel and track, reducing heat generation, protecting against corrosion, and extending the overall lifespan of the flange.
Yes. While they are engineered to fit the standard 1435mm gauge precisely, we offer custom sizing and gauge compatibility options to meet specific application needs.
Our wheels adhere to strict international railway safety and performance standards, specifically AAR M-208 and UIC 812-3, ensuring reliability in global industrial operations.
The P1 profile ensures even weight distribution across the contact patch. This reduces localized stress on the rails and the wheel, allowing the vehicle to carry heavy cargo with minimal vibration and maximum stability.

High Angle CV Axles: The Ultimate Guide to Performance and Durability In the world of automotive engineering, particularly for lifted trucks and off-road vehicles, the drivetrain faces immense stress. One of the most critical components in this system is the constant velocity joint. When a vehicles suspension is raised, the angle at which the axle meets the differential increases, often leading to premature wear or failure in standard parts. This is where high angle cv axles become indispensable. By allowing for a greater range of motion without sacrificing torque delivery, these specialized components ensure that your vehicle remains reliable regardless of the terrain.
